So I'm out at the lake Saturday morning. the boat is running great as usual. Well, I went to put the boat back on the trailer when something strange happen.
When I goosed the throttle to put it up on the trailer,the boat motor jumped out of gear.I tried to return it to neutral and it went back. I tried forward again and it just wouldn't go in gear.So I tried to put it in reverse. Nothing :-(.

I put it up on the trailer by hand and started pulling out. I then realized that the boat needed about four more inches to be on the trailer good.
So I back back down, and while I'm pushing it on I decide to start the motor up and try once again to put it in gear.
The same thing happened. It sounds like the gears aren't quite meshing together? I did have reverse when I tried it this time.
Any ideas on what the problem might be?

Ok, so I had someone came over and look at the motor tonight.
He looked the motor over, and then went to the linkage. He said that the boat had recently had a motor put on the boat.
Apparently the previous owner had burnt the first motor up and replaced it.
He thought that the linkage might not had been adjusted properly when the replacement motor was put on.

He also said that when I slightly bumped the concrete ramp it might not have been in gear all the way.Causing it to bump out of gear and to chip at little metal off.
Anyway, he adjusted the cables and it feels right now.
I pulled the drain plug and found no water in the lower end. The motor oil looked very clean for me running it as hard as I did last year. There were two very small pieces (1/4" long x .003"thick) of metal found when the drain plug was removed.

He advised me to take to the lake and try it out on the trailer first. He showed me how to adjust the linkage if needed but felt pretty sure that it was just in the linkage at this point. Whew,..........
